Understanding the Platform Differences
Wheelbase Specifications
The fundamental distinction between these platforms lies in their wheelbase measurements, which directly impact vehicle dynamics and interior space.
The Defender 90 features a 92.9-inch wheelbase, making it the most compact and agile option. This shorter wheelbase translates to superior maneuverability on tight trails and urban environments.
The Defender 110 extends to a 110-inch wheelbase, striking the optimal balance between interior space and off-road capability. This platform has become the most popular choice among restoration enthusiasts for good reason.
The Defender 130 stretches to a 127-inch wheelbase, prioritizing cargo capacity and passenger space over tight-quarter maneuverability. This platform excels in applications requiring maximum utility.
Overall Length Impact
Platform length affects more than just parking convenience. The 90 measures approximately 142 inches overall, while the 110 extends to 159 inches, and the 130 reaches 178 inches.
These dimensions influence approach and departure angles, with shorter platforms typically offering better breakover capability on steep terrain.

Key Considerations for Platform Selection
Intended Use Analysis
Daily driving favors different platforms depending on your lifestyle. The 90 excels in urban environments with its compact footprint and easier parking. City dwellers often prefer this platform for its everyday practicality.
Family adventures typically benefit from the 110's versatility. This platform provides adequate seating for five adults while maintaining reasonable cargo space for weekend gear.
Commercial applications or large family needs often require the 130's extended capacity. This platform can accommodate up to nine passengers or substantial cargo loads.
Off-Road Performance Characteristics
Approach and departure angles vary significantly between platforms. The 90 typically achieves the best angles at approximately 47 degrees approach and 35 degrees departure.
The 110 maintains respectable angles while offering improved stability on uneven terrain. Its longer wheelbase provides better weight distribution and reduced likelihood of high-centering.
The 130 sacrifices some extreme capability for improved on-road stability and cargo capacity. However, skilled drivers can still tackle challenging terrain with proper technique.

Technical Deep Dive
Structural Engineering
The chassis design remains fundamentally similar across platforms, with galvanized steel construction providing exceptional durability. However, the longer platforms include additional cross-members for structural integrity.
Load distribution characteristics change with wheelbase length. The 110 and 130 platforms can handle heavier rear loads without significantly affecting front axle weight distribution.
Suspension geometry adaptations accommodate the different wheelbases while maintaining Land Rover's proven coil-spring or leaf-spring setups depending on the model year.
Engine and Transmission Compatibility
All three platforms share engine mounting configurations, allowing for consistent powerplant options during restoration. Popular choices include the 300TDI, TD5, and various petrol engines.
Transmission compatibility remains consistent, though longer platforms may benefit from different final drive ratios to optimize performance with their increased weight.
Cooling system requirements may vary slightly with platform length, particularly in expedition-configured vehicles with additional accessories.
Weight and Capacity Analysis
| Platform | Curb Weight | Payload Capacity | Towing Capacity |
|---|---|---|---|
| 90 | ~3,500 lbs | ~1,500 lbs | ~7,700 lbs |
| 110 | ~3,800 lbs | ~1,400 lbs | ~7,700 lbs |
| 130 | ~4,100 lbs | ~2,900 lbs | ~7,700 lbs |
The 130's significantly higher payload capacity makes it ideal for commercial applications or heavy expedition builds requiring substantial gear.
Technical Note: These figures represent typical specifications and may vary based on model year, engine choice, and specific configuration options.
Platform-Specific Advantages
Defender 90 Benefits
Urban maneuverability stands out as the 90's primary strength. Tight parking spaces, narrow streets, and city traffic become manageable challenges rather than obstacles.
Fuel economy typically improves with the reduced weight and aerodynamic profile. Long-distance touring becomes more economical without sacrificing the essential Defender character.
Extreme off-roading capabilities shine on technical trails where every inch of wheelbase matters. Rock crawling and tight switchbacks favor the compact dimensions.
Defender 110 Advantages
Versatility defines the 110 platform better than any single characteristic. This wheelbase handles family duties, weekend adventures, and moderate commercial tasks with equal competence.
Resale value traditionally remains strong for well-executed 110 restorations. The broad appeal translates to market stability and investment security.
Parts availability reaches its peak with 110 components due to the platform's popularity during the production years.
Defender 130 Applications
Commercial viability makes the 130 platform attractive for businesses requiring dependable utility vehicles. Safari operations, construction sites, and agricultural applications benefit from the extended capacity.
Large family transportation becomes practical with proper seating configurations. Nine-passenger capability addresses needs that smaller platforms cannot accommodate.
Expedition preparation allows for comprehensive systems integration. Water storage, auxiliary power, and extended-range fuel systems fit more easily within the generous dimensions.
